Gianni Infantino’s hopes of surviving as FIFA president have been boosted after 4 Asian nations publicly backed him following the abolition of divisive plans to promote stakes within the World Cup.

UEFA partnered with the North, Central America and Caribbean confederation (CONCACAF) and the Asian Soccer Confederation (AFC) to drive Infantino to drop plans to promote a £3.1 billion stake within the World Cup to personal traders.

UEFA and CONCACAF have since known as on Infantino to stop – however their ploy to depose the Swiss soccer administrator has hit a roadblock after Kuwait, Qatar, Sri Lanka and Lebanon reiterated their confidence in his management.

UEFA and CONCACAF make up 90 of FIFA’s 211 member associations. Though that is sufficient to set off a vote of no confidence – solely 20 per cent of FIFA’s membership is required – it falls in need of the bulk wanted to topple Infantino.

With Infantino retaining assist from Africa whereas South America are anticipated to take the identical place, AFC members could be required to oust the FIFA president. Morocco, co-hosts of the subsequent World Cup, launched an announcement

New Zealand may be a part of Europe and CONCACAF’s resistance, however it’s uncertain that the remaining 10 members of the Oceania Soccer Confederation would observe go well with.

In an announcement welcoming the choice to desert the non-public fairness proposal, the AFC avoided defying the FIFA management.

The following championing by Kuwait, Qatar, Sri Lanka and Lebanon bolstered the impression that Infantino retains vital backing throughout Asia. 

The opposite 40 AFC member associations have but to remark publicly, suggesting they assist the affiliation’s assertion, which doesn’t problem his presidency.

Australia, additionally an AFC member, welcomed the choice to scrap the funding plan and stated: ‘Consideration should now flip to the long run.’

Whereas UEFA and CONCACAF have sufficient assist to drive a vote of no confidence, they don’t at present have the numbers to take away Infantino.

Public opposition stands at 43 per cent of FIFA’s membership, under the bulk required to unseat him.

That stated, the undeclared associations won’t essentially vote in a block with their confederations.  

If 16 nations have been to interrupt ranks and be a part of the opposition, Infantino’s presidency could be in a dangerous place.

On Saturday, AFC president Sheikh Salman bin Ibrahim Al Khalifa stated: ‘I’m proud that every one our member associations stood united and entrusted the AFC with looking for solutions on their behalf concerning this significant difficulty regarding the way forward for world soccer governance.

‘I thank them for his or her endurance, solidarity, and unity, and I guarantee them that the AFC will at all times act of their finest pursuits. 

‘The way forward for world soccer should at all times be formed by means of sound session, collective dialogue, and respect for the established governance constructions of our sport.’

UEFA, nonetheless, took a extra direct place: ‘UEFA welcomes FIFA’s determination to withdraw its plan to promote a stake in its competitions – together with the World Cup – into non-public arms.

‘The proposal was unanimously rejected by UEFA’s nationwide associations and by many different federations and confederations of all sizes all over the world, whose job it’s to guard soccer.

‘We can’t maintain occurring like this with secret schemes on fast-track timescales, cooked up by faceless people and of doubtful profit to the sport. We should determine these accountable and maintain them to account.

‘It’s proper that, within the coming days and weeks, UEFA will work with its associations and in shut cooperation with different confederations to mirror on how this occurred and devise a plan to guarantee that it can’t happen once more.

‘That evaluate needs to be thorough and basic. No possibility needs to be off the desk. The present FIFA management has not solely misplaced UEFA’s confidence but in addition that of many different members of the soccer household.

‘The shabby, back-room, opaque deal he hatched and tried to drive by means of was something however clear. This can be a victory for the entire sport. Nevertheless it should not be the tip of the story. The proposal has gone. The duty of rebuilding belief in FIFA has solely simply begun.’

Numerous European nations, together with England, Wales, the Netherlands and Norway, endorsed the assertion.

A spokeswoman for the English FA added: ‘We absolutely assist UEFA’s place. It’s time for a full and sturdy evaluate of FIFA’s management and governance to make sure that the worldwide sport is run transparently, for the good thing about all 211 member nations and with the long-term stewardship of soccer at its coronary heart.’

CONCACAF, as they’ve all week, adopted go well with: ‘CONCACAF and its 41 Member Associations welcome the withdrawal of the proposed FIFA Ahead Enterprise (FFE).

‘The Confederation additionally commends its 41 Member Associations and the broader soccer household for the braveness and unity they’ve proven this week. 

‘At a second that demanded principled management, our members stood collectively in defence of soccer’s long-term pursuits and the ideas of fine governance. That unity has prevailed.

‘A proposal of this magnitude doesn’t attain that stage by chance. It’s a symptom of management that has stopped placing soccer first. 

‘This latest unilateral and egregious act of poor governance and management follows a sample of missteps and related behaviour. A full evaluate of this management should now happen.

‘This concern isn’t CONCACAF’s alone. It’s shared throughout many confederations, Member Associations and those that serve and love the sport. 

‘When individuals entrusted with defending the sport conclude they’ll not achieve this from inside, the soccer household is entitled to ask how such a proposal was allowed to proceed, and who bears duty for it.’
